This morning Rightmove produced its half year results to the stock market and had given a good insight into exactly how strong the housing market is.
From a conveyancers perspective Rightmove has over 940,000 properties listed on its portal and is as good a bell weather of the housing market as you are going to get.
The report states:
“Home hunter demand has been strong since our customers started re-opening their businesses from 13 May, supported by changes in consumer needs and the recent announcement of temporary stamp duty holidays across the UK. Since 13 May we have recorded 65 days beating Rightmove’s previous traffic record set on 19 February 2020. Between 1 June and 31 July demand for sales properties has been 50% higher than the same period in 2019 with rental demand being over 20% higher.”
Peter Brooks-Johnson, Chief Executive Officer, said:
“Following the reopening of the housing market on 13 May housing market activity is at record levels, with evidence of new home hunters coming into the market with changing needs as they reassess their priorities and further incentivised by the temporary stamp duty holiday. Rightmove has extended its lead as the place home hunters turn to first for their move. It’s quite incredible that 65 of our record days have been since 13 May. I’m pleased that our customers are choosing to invest in our digital solutions to take advantage of this record demand.”
The report also indicated risks associated with a second wave and uncertainty as to how long the heighted housing market activity will continue.
